Transaction edb771e41d173aa7965d129248e279bfc9b35fe1aa50d97530cb653f9f207866
1 Input
1 Output
-
edb771e41d173aa7965d129248e279bfc9b35fe1aa50d97530cb653f9f207866:0
- value
- 15802417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10bda81168215a4d09565aeddd4045b934d9c9bf OP_EQUAL
- address
- 33DXwBKcUkhvwrYNrZhqLEGhJDusXxf9bj